Outline

  • ✓ Interactive rebasing with both the traditional squash, reword and edit, in addition to the new fixup and autosquash.
  • ✓ Understanding the modes of git reset and how it affects, preserves, or destructs the history, index, and working directory.
  • ✓ Searching through history with string, combination, and pickaxe approaches.
  • ✓ Diffing changes past refactorings.
  • ✓ Finding the original author of methods in refactored and relocated code.
  • ✓ Administratively shaping history with git filter-branch at milestones or after a Subversion import.
  • ✓ Minimizing repetitive merge efforts with rerere.
  • ✓ Controlling pull and push behavior with advanced configuration options.
  • ✓ Manually editing the refspec and git config files.
  • ✓ Pushing to and pulling from multiple destinations.
  • ✓ Tag signing, tag merging, and signed tag business scenarios.
  • ✓ Adding Git notes and their effective namespace use.
  • ✓ Relocating chunks of work with rebase onto
  • ✓ Leveraging several other cutting-edge Git 1.8 features.
